Keep everyday plates, bowls, and cups on the easiest-to-reach shelf
Store heavy items like pots, pans, and small appliances on lower shelves
Place frequently used cooking tools near the stove
Keep baking items together in one section
Group food items by type, such as snacks, canned goods, pasta, and spices
Store lids with their matching containers
Use clear bins or baskets to separate small items
Put cleaning supplies in one designated cabinet
Keep rarely used items on higher shelves
Arrange items by size, with larger items at the back and smaller items in front
Use shelf risers to create more vertical space
Store cutting boards upright if possible
Keep sharp tools in a safe, separate area
Place mugs near the coffee or tea station
Keep pantry staples together in labeled containers
Leave space for easy access and quick cleanup
